Default 02 plate S80 D5 auto

I'm going to be selling for a friend due to the owner passing away a silver 02 plate S80 D5 auto, as it was mainly me who has looked after it for last 3 years

I think the car had around 230k on clock last time i saw it but had a replacement engine fitted by me at 120k due to aux belt failure,

It was used mainly to travel from castleford to darlington to work and back and to sites round country he was inspecting,

Since i fitted engine it has been service every 12k and has gearbox flushed a couple of times, had new genuine belts and tensioners fitted not so long ago and new intercooler,

It also has a private plate which i think will be going with the car,

Ill get some more info when i pick the car up at weekend and have a good look over it ready for MOT,

If i didn't already have my xc90 i would have stuck a towbar on it and kept it,

Would anybody be interested, don't have a price or pics yet as ive not seen car for a while due to owner been poorly and not doing the miles it used to do but from last time i saw it i believe its worth saving from scrapyard,
